Clark State vs. Chamberlain University-Ohio
Both Clark State College and Chamberlain University-Ohio are 4 years schools located in Ohio. The following statements compare Clark State College and Chamberlain University-Ohio with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
- Chamberlain University-Ohio's tuition ($19,740) is more expensive than Clark State ($7,809).

- Chamberlain University-Ohio's students to faculty ratio (7 to 1) is lower than Clark State (13 to 1).
- Clark State (4,724 students) is larger than Chamberlain University-Ohio (336 students) with more enrolled students.
- Chamberlain University-Ohio ($5,307) has higher amount of financial aid than Clark State ($4,962).
- Both schools have same graduation rate of 25%.
